English to Spanish Dictionary auditorium

auditorium

sala
definition
noun
The gallery looks more like an old theatre auditorium , with a dress circle, an upper circle, and boxes on the sides.
the part of a theater, concert hall, or other public building in which the audience sits.
See the massive dance floors proposed for the auditorium and sports hall.
a large building or hall used for public gatherings, typically speeches or stage performances.
